Abstract

The invention discloses a demo instrument for demonstrating the skin effect based on a method of measuring resistance equivalently. The demo instrument comprises a box body, an interaction machine connected to the box body and a signal collecting unit. A signal generator and a skin effect generation unit electrically connected to the signal generator are arranged in the box body; the interaction machine is electrically connected to the signal generator and adjusts signal parameters in the signal generator input into the signal generator; a signal stream generated by the signal generator passesthrough the skin effect generation unit and has the skin effect on the skin effect generation unit. The signal collecting unit collects an electric signal of the skin effect generation unit and outputs a digital waveform image to display the skin effect. The demo instrument has a human-machine interaction function, can achieve the demand of high precision and high reliability in a certain error range, and improves the expression and display intuition of the skin effect mechanism and overcomes the defect that a skin effect teaching model is too abstractive, complex and hard to understand.

Description

technical field [0001] The invention relates to the technical field of skin effect demonstration instruments, in particular to a demonstration instrument for demonstrating skin effect based on an equivalent resistance measurement method. Background technique [0002] The skin effect causes the resistance of the conductor to increase as the frequency of the alternating current increases, and causes the efficiency of the wire to transmit current to decrease, consuming metal resources. The influence of skin effect must be considered in the design of radio frequency, microwave circuit and power transmission system. [0003] The existing skin effect demonstrator is composed of two identical circular thin iron columns and two identical small electric beads, one of which is welded on the axis of the two thin iron columns, and the other B is symmetrical Welded on the exterior.
